Output a20c8a70621cde4e07b9e46c4ac43f1683879aefd0ae76be7b6a01ecc5e0fcbe:21

value
26510000
script pubkey
OP_0 OP_PUSHBYTES_20 18ec7b530de536666a55ee894016a3a09e7d6792
address
bc1qrrk8k5cdu5mxv6j4a6y5q94r5z086eujuf9e6g
transaction
a20c8a70621cde4e07b9e46c4ac43f1683879aefd0ae76be7b6a01ecc5e0fcbe
spent
true